Is this normal? or not


Question Posted Saturday July 22 2006, 3:06 pm

I like to dye my hair but everytime i dye my hair dark it fades like completely out within 2 weeks (i use the $10 boxed stuff) but when i dye my hair like a light shade of sandy brown/blonde it holds and really doesn't fade at all every (well i have had the hair dye in for about 5 weeks and i have noticed no fading)

My question is why is this? my hair is naturally extremely dark brown and my hair was a med brown and i keep trying to dye it back to my natural color but then it fades to a light brown red which isn't even close to my natural color or the color it was before and its ugly and looks bad when my roots grow in.

And it looks alright light but my hair looks really good dark and i want to be able to keep it that way and i want tips so i don't always have to get it professionally colored

more_than_a_feeling answered Saturday July 22 2006, 8:38 pm:
Wash your hair with a color-safe shampoo such as Garnier Fructis for Colored or Permed Hair and only shampoo 2-3 times a week. All the other days, just condition it. Avoid pools because chlorine eats away at hair dye.
